    In your opinion, if you were to properly delete your truck, how many less issues would you have? Great videos!

    • @CFarmer
      @CFarmer  2 года назад +1

      If i would have deleted when i bought it.... I wouldn't have had to replace the def injector and the nox sensors. That's the only issues can think of that i can think of that would've been removed during the delete. In my opinion i would still have injector connector issues and that's the main issue i have with mine. I also believe by not deleting i have cost myself engine life in the long run. The emissions make the engine work so much harder. I have also had exceptional luck out of my dpf filter. I don't personally know anyone else that has put over 400k on a stock dpf filter. I also believe if i was deleted my transmission would have probably went out long ago the way i beat on this one

    Do you know if there is a specific symptoms that the truck does when ever the injector pig tail goes out? My 2018 started jerking a little on my way to work and CEL light came on along with REDUCED ENGINE POWER and Code
    p0205- p0305- p02ce p02cc
    I have around 200k miles it's running super rough right now.

    • @CFarmer
      @CFarmer  2 года назад

      That would be the #5 injector connector. It's second from the back on the passenger side right by #7(very back on passenger side).
